Is it worth pursuing B.E./B.Tech at Government Engineering College, Jhalawar (GECJ)?
Here's an overview of the pros and cons of pursuing B.E./B.Tech at GECJ:
Infrastructure and Facilities
* Good infrastructure, with modern buildings and amenities
* Wi-Fi connectivity throughout the campus
* Decent libraries and laboratories, although some may require improvement
* Good hostels, with separate accommodations for boys and girls
* Indoor and outdoor recreational facilities, such as gyms, basketball courts, and playgrounds

The fees range for courses offerred by the Government Engineering College, Jhalawar (GECJ) is around INR 57150 - INR 196000.
